Problem in the code for the adjustment of the length of the column

I have a column of the item on the stores of the order of the day that this column must be 9 digits
I'm labour code and examine the field if found 8 figures put zero on the left
But this code does not work as I want it, although the implementation was done without errors

DECLARE
V_ITEM INVENTORIES. TYPE % INV_ITEM;
START FOR ITEM_CUR IN (SELECT * FROM INVENTORIES) LOOP
IF length (V_ITEM) = 8 then
UPDATE OF INVENTORIES SET INV_ITEM = 0 | V_ITEM;
END IF;
END LOOP;
END;

Dear OracleLover2,

All columns have the same data because there is no where clause in the update statement and that's why it would update all records.

I don't know what should be the condition for the update, because this is business logic, which you need to know.

There was the fundamental problem in the code that I pointed out above in my last comment.

You write once appropriate where clause in your query of update, it will give you the desired results.

It will be useful.

Check the answer as useful / OK, if this can help you

Carole

Tags: Database

Similar Questions

  • I have a problem check my code for Lightroom 6 help please, the site says code cannot be verified. I have an existing application of Lightroom 2 and I paid for the upgrade

    I have a problem check my code for Lightroom 6 help please, the site says code cannot be verified. I have an existing application of Lightroom 2 and I paid for the upgrade

    If you purchased the version of LR 6 upgrade then when you install and run for the first time it asks you to Sign In. You must sign in with the same Adobe ID you used to buy it. Then once it's a window will appear asking for a serial number. In this window, you enter the serial number LR 6 What adobe sent you. Then once that went into a second serial number box will appear asking for a serial number from a previous version. Then you enter the serial number LR 2. Series LR 2 will begin with the same 4 numbers, 1160.

  • What is the problem in this code for loop? Help, please

    I have 9 text boxes Dynamics txt1, txt2, txt3... txt9 and I want to track the number of these dynamic text boxes that contain text only

    var i: Number;
    for (i = 0; i < 10; i ++) {}
    If (cela ['txt' + i] .length > 0)

    trace (i);
    }

    This code shows the numbers from 1 to 9 If the text boxes contained a text or not, how can I do find only filled? Thank you

    You can have a lot of problems using the variable of the textfield object and there is no advantage to using it.

    But if you choose to ignore this advice, you must ensure that your textfields and not html enabled, are not multi-line, and did not apply kerning.

    It is for beginners.  If this is ok with you, you can use:

    var nonEmptyTFNum:Number = 0;

    for (var i: Number = 1; i<>

    {If (cela ["txt" + i]! = undefined & {this ["txt" + i] .length > 0})}

    nonEmptyTFNum ++;

    }

    }

    trace (nonEmptyTFNum);

  • Pop up problem when the column value

    Hi all

    I am facing on the issue when we have Disabled_Enabled_By_Conc = disabled so only I need to show the pop-up message, but it is displayed in the case of Disabled_Enabled_By_Conc = Enabled. Please notify. Please note I use event = change of element =Disabled_Enabled_By_Conc.

    Disabled.jpg

    Report Is Disabled.jpg

    Hi all

    Problem is resolved now, as in alert, I disabled the loading of the page in dynamic condition and it solved the problem.

  • How to set the content of the column for lines of automatic separation

    Hello guys,.

    I have a problem with the column width and the content of column in a standard report. In the report are hugh entries that are not interrupted by a space character. I put my column width to a special value by usingen "style css: display block; Width: 300px; ». Now the problem is that some of the entries in the column with a longer width that the column width is set. Then they overlock the entries in the column next to them.

    My question is: How to set the column lines of automatic content break after a certain number of characters?

    After searching for a couple of websites and discussion thread, I found maybe a reference to the solution. I hope that it helps you to give me an answer.

    A4 FORMAT LAST_NAME COLUMN
    */*

    concerning

    wderr

    Wderr,

    It is more a matter of HTML as a matter of APEX... You can start by looking here:
    http://www.456bereastreet.com/archive/200704/how_to_prevent_html_tables_from_becoming_too_wide/

    Kind regards
    Dan

    Blog: http://DanielMcGhan.us/
    Work: http://SkillBuilders.com/

  • Value of the column used as a column in the join

    We have three tables
    Product table          
    Pno     Pname     Htype1     Htype2
    101     ABC     Ltype1     
                   
    Loc Table          
    LocId      LocName Ltype1 Ltype2
                   
                   
    TransportTable          
    Tid     Ttype     LocId     
    I need to create the query like this
    begin
    
    select Ltype1 into v_type
    from Product 
    where Product = 101;
    
    for x in (select t.Tid,t.Lid 
                 from Loc l,Transport t
              where l.locid = T.locid
                    and t.ttype = 'l.'|| v_type ) --- Getting Problem when the column 
                           which is set in Htype1 in Product table to be used to join here
        loop
    Can you pls suggest/help me how to use the colum that is located in Htype1 in the Product table
    to be used in the cursor?

    Thank you very much

    Published by: user12093849 on August 2, 2010 06:32

    Published by: user12093849 on August 2, 2010 06:32

    Hello

    As Sven said, the paintings were not designed for a relational database. The longer term solution wouold be redisgn the tables of a relational database.

    The fundamental problem is that identifiers (such as column names) should be hardcoded in the query when compiling. You cannot use variables.
    You can use variables in the Dynamic SQL statements , where the application is not compiled until the time of execution. I find this easier to do in SQL * more, using the substitutuion variables, but you can do dynamic SQL in PL/SQL, too.

    Depending on the data types involved, something like that can work for you as well:

    SELECT     t.tid
    ,     l.lid
    FROM     loc          l
    ,     transport     t
    ,     product          p
    WHERE     p.product     = 101
    AND     l.locid          = t.locid
    AND     t.ttype          = CASE  p.htype1
                         WHEN  'Ltype1'     THEN  lytpe1
                         WHEN  'Ltype2'     THEN  lytpe2
                     END
    ;
    

    This is likely to be less effective than other alternatives.

  • Having a problem with the update of the window. He said that windows could not search for new updates. It's the found error 80245003 code

    Having a problem with the update of the window. He said that windows could not search for new updates. It's the found error 80245003 code

    Take a look at this article as it addresses this error code. Mike - Engineer Support Microsoft Answers
    Visit our Microsoft answers feedback Forum and let us know what you think.

  • Cannot install Vista service pack 2 is 800f0a09 error code with the message that there are problems with the driver for dell latitude

    Original title: why I get error code 800f0a09 to upgrade to windows vista service pack 2

    I have a laptop del that is running on Windows Vista Edition Home Premium. I tried to download itunes but it requires service pack 2. Whenever I try to update to service pack 2, I get the message following error code 800F0A09. He also mentioned problems with the driver for dell latitude. What can I do to fix this please.

    Thank you

    Hello

    Please join Microsoft Community where you can find the necessary information on Microsoft products!

    You can not install Vista Service pack 2 and get the error with code 800f0a09 and the message that there are problems with the driver for dell latitude.

    The problem may occur if some of the components of the update are corrupt.

    What is the full error message that you receive?

    I suggest you follow the steps mentioned below to check if the problem is with the update components:

    Method 1: Reset the update components

    See the site:

    How to reset the Windows Update components?

    http://support.Microsoft.com/kb/971058

    Warning: This section, method, or task contains steps that tell you how to modify the registry. However, serious problems can occur if you modify the registry incorrectly. Therefore, make sure that you proceed with caution. For added protection, back up the registry before you edit it. Then you can restore the registry if a problem occurs. For more information about how to back up and restore the registry, click on the number below to view the article in the Microsoft Knowledge Base:

    http://Windows.Microsoft.com/en-us/Windows-Vista/back-up-the-registry

    Method 2: Run the system update readiness tool

     

    See the site:

    System update scan tool corrects errors of Windows Update in Windows 8, Windows 7, Windows Vista, Windows Server 2008 R2 and Windows Server 2008

    http://support.Microsoft.com/kb/947821

    Method 3: Turn off the antivirus software

     

    See the site:

    Disable the anti-virus software

    http://Windows.Microsoft.com/en-in/Windows-Vista/disable-antivirus-software

    Important note: Antivirus software can help protect your computer against viruses and other security threats. In most cases, you should not disable your antivirus software. If you need to disable temporarily to install other software, you must reactivate as soon as you are finished. If you are connected to the Internet or a network, while your antivirus software is disabled, your computer is vulnerable to attacks.

    I hope this helps. If the problem persists, let know us and we would be happy to help you.

  • Failed to perform recovery of factory setting - error 0x8007045D Code / product key error - "ERROR!" We encountered a problem with the request for approval.

    Original title: product key error

    Hi all...

    I have ' tried to download the disc Image of Windows 7 (ISO file), but when I insert my product key, the system cannot check it.
    I use the laptop Sony Vaio VPC EG35EG with preinstalled Windows 7 Home Basic 64 bit inside.
    Now, after that there is error (I cannot yet perform plant pose recovery; always finished with error 0x8007045D Code), I need to install clean my laptop with the USB or DVD Installer key. But then, when I try to download it, my product key (I found it on the sticker at the bottom of the laptop) are not validated by microsoft. It is said:

    "ERROR!" We encountered a problem with the request for approval.

    What should I do now? Y does it can someone help me?
    Thank you.

    Consider the following text:

    How to: What are my options for Windows 7 reinstall media?

    Make sure you scroll down and read the section:

    What to do if you cannot get your manufacturer recovery media, refuse to use or to buy it or the Microsoft Software Recovery Website does not work?

    also check:

    https://techingiteasy.WordPress.com/2012/04/13/how-to-activate-Windows-7-OEM-license-using-a-retail-disc/

  • Video device USB has a driver problem__ __There is a problem with the driver for USB video Device.__Device information __Name: __ID USB video device: USB\VID_05CA & PID_180C & MI_00\6 & 69C3BD0 & 0 & 0000 code __Error: 10 _ _ _

    I hava a dell inspiron 1440 with windows 7 and a a few days ago, my webcam was working just fine but know that it gives me this after troubleshooting

    Has a USB video device driver problem
    Not fixed
    There is a problem with the driver for USB video device. The driver must be reinstalled.
    The device information
    Name: USB video device
    ID: USB\VID_05CA & PID_180C & MI_00\6 & 69C3BD0 & 0 & 0000
    Error code: 10

    Hey laloo.16,

    As the error message states clearly that reinstalling the driver is required, please do the same. You can uninstall the driver that is currently installed from the Device Manager.
    To access Device Manager:
    1. go to start and type Device Manager.
    2. Select Device Manager in the control panel list.
    3. go to your device.
    4. to remove:
    Right-click on it and select Properties.
    5. Select the driver tab and click on uninstall to uninstall the existing driver.
    6. close Device Manager.
    Now go to the link below. Download the Dell WebCam software for your product.

    http://support.Dell.com/support/downloads/DriversList.aspx?OS=W732&CATID=-1&DateID=-1&impid=-1&OSL=en&typeid=-1&FormatID=-1&SERVICETAG=&SystemID=INSPIRON1440&hidos=WLH&hidlang=en&TabIndex =

    Please choose the appropriate version of Windows 7.  Install the driver and see if that brings your webcam to work.

    Kind regards

    Shinmila H - Microsoft Support

    Visit our Microsoft answers feedback Forum and let us know what you think.

  • There is a problem with the driver for Ralink Bluetooth PCIe Adapter. The driver must be reinstalled error code 39.

    HP Pavilion 17 laptop

    There is a problem with the driver for Ralink Bluetooth PCIe Adapter. The driver must be reinstalled.

    OT: Driver help

    Name: PCIe Ralink Bluetooth adapter
    Error code: 39

    Hello

    Thanks for posting the query on the Microsoft Community Forums. You have reached the right place. Let us work together to find the cause of this problem and try to solve.

    What is the number of full model of the laptop?

    39 error code means Windows cannot load the driver for this hardware device. The driver may be corrupted or missing. To resolve the problem, you will need to uninstall and reinstall the drivers for Ralink Bluetooth PCIe card on the manufacturer's Web site.

    I hope this helps. Let us know if you have other problems with Windows in the future.

  • CSS code for the background of the image problem fixed

    Hello world
    I struggled for almost 2 days on and outside to try to understand why I can't get the codes for a fixed background work properly. I'll copy the code here directly and hope that someone can see what the problem is. I also give a link to the site I'm just starting to be implemented.
    http://seanshaw.NET So you can see the source code here... Any help would be greatly appreciated as I have tried 3 different versions of the code fixed background and none of them does not work for me. What Miss me? :)

    Thanks for any help on this problem... Best regards, Jo Whimzicals.com

    The code that I currently use is this one... I take you from the top to the body tag:

    <! D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ional / / IN".
    " http://www.w3.org/TR/html4/loose.dtd" >
    < html >
    < head >
    < style type = "text/css" >
    body
    {
    background-image:
    URL ('BckgndHome.gif');
    background-repeat:
    no-repeat;
    background-attachment:
    fixed
    }
    < / style >
    < title > Sean Shaw Art, Art of Sean Shaw < /title >
    < meta http-equiv = "Content-Type" content = text/html"; charset = iso-8859-1 ">"
    < style type = "text/css" >
    <!--
    body, td, th {}
    do-family: Verdana, Arial, Helvetica, without serif.
    }
    {body
    background-image: url(Home/BckgndHome.gif);
    }
    {.style2}
    do-size: 18px;
    color: #FFFFFF;
    }
    .style3 {color: #FFFFFF}
    ->
    < / style > < / head >

    < body >
    ==============================
    Just to clarify things, I also tried these two codes, that makes perfect sense to me, but they still do not work for me.
    ==============================
    < style type = "text/css" >
    Body {background: url (fixedbg.gif) set of Center no-repeat ;}}
    < / style >
    =======================
    ... and this one...

    < html >
    < head >

    < style type = "text/css" >
    body
    {
    background-image:
    URL ('image.gif')
    }
    < / style >

    < / head >

    < body >
    < / body >

    < / html >

    Ahhhhhhhh, Thank you VERY MUCH, ACE! I found and removed the second command line, and you were quite right... the bottom now remains in place and works perfectly. Thank you for taking the time to help me... Awesome. Have an awesome Sunday... Best regards, Jo :)))

  • What is the Code for error AHT 4HDD/11 / 40000004:SATA (0,0)

    What is the Code for error AHT 4HDD/11 / 40000004:SATA (0,0)

    This means you have a hardware problem related to the hard drive. The disk may be corrupted or fails and must be replaced. Save your file as soon as POSSIBLE. If the player does not have little time for the backup.

  • HP officejet 7612: "There is a problem with the printer or ink system". That is the message, no error code.

    "Is there a problem with the printer or the ink system". The error message. Without error code. Original cartridges.

    HP has a center of service to Puerto Rico, where I live?

    Please tell me there is a solution for this problem.

    In the paper here troubleshooting steps can help resolve the printer ink system message justify Officejet 7612.

  • Hi.I download Microsoft Security Essentials and installation becomes a problem with the code: 0 x 80070643. If you can help me...

    Hi.I download Microsoft Security Essentials and installation becomes a problem with the code: 0 x 80070643. If you can help me...

    Support Microsoft Security Essentials forums
    http://social.answers.Microsoft.com/forums/en-us/category/MSE

    Can I install Microsoft Security Essentials [or any other anti-virus/anti-spyware application] to clean my already infected computer?
    http://social.answers.Microsoft.com/forums/en-us/msescan/thread/87058857-D181-4019-a723-efd9a49d9275

    ~ Robear Dyer (PA Bear) ~ MS MVP (that is to say, mail, security, Windows & Update Services) since 2002 ~ WARNING: MS MVPs represent or work for Microsoft

Maybe you are looking for